Walgreens Boots Alliance has received regulatory approval to buy 1,900 Rite Aid stores from the Pennsylvania-based drugstore chain for $4.4 billion. The deal will make Walgreens (NASDAQ: WBA) the country's largest retail pharmacy by store locations – putting the Deerfield, Illinois-based company ahead of CVS and other rivals. The sale agreement was modified ahead of the Federal Trade Commission granting approval.
